Asian markets settle mostly higher on Friday

29 Dec 2023 Evaluate
Asian markets settled mostly higher on Friday, the last trading day of 2023. Market sentiments improved after data that the number of Americans filing initial claims for unemployment benefits rose more than expected last week added to optimism about the outlook for Fed’s interest rates. Chinese shares gained as the country’s tech firms continued their advance. However, Japanese shares declined ahead of a lengthy New Year’s holiday break. But Nikkei index finished up 28% from a year earlier and ending at its highest level since 1989. South Korean markets were closed for a holiday.
